Why Visual Inspection Is Impossible
For the average consumer, discerning whether a chicken contains antibiotics is not possible through physical examination. Antibiotic residues are tasteless, odorless, and do not alter the chicken's color or texture. The assumption that conventional chicken is visibly different from a bird raised without antibiotics is a myth. Any detection of residues requires specialized and expensive laboratory equipment, such as High-Performance Liquid Chromatography (HPLC) or mass spectrometry, which are used by regulatory agencies and researchers, not for consumer use.
The presence of antibiotics in poultry is a complex issue stemming from various farming practices. In conventional farming, antibiotics may be used therapeutically to treat disease, for disease prevention, and, historically, for growth promotion. To ensure food safety, government regulations require a mandatory 'withdrawal period' before the animal is processed, during which no antibiotics are administered. The goal is to ensure that any residual drugs have cleared the bird's system before it reaches the market. However, consumer skepticism and scientific studies finding residue contamination suggest that this system is not always foolproof.
Decoding Chicken Labels for a Healthier Diet
Since you cannot see, smell, or taste antibiotic residues, the power to make an informed choice lies entirely in understanding and trusting food labels. Here’s a breakdown of what the most important labels mean:
- Raised Without Antibiotics/No Antibiotics Ever: This is one of the most straightforward and reliable claims. It means the chickens were never administered antibiotics at any point in their life cycle. This is different from the generic 'antibiotic-free' claim, which can be misleading as all chicken is technically antibiotic-free by the time it's sold if withdrawal periods are followed.
- Certified Organic: A USDA Organic seal indicates that the chicken was raised according to strict federal standards. This includes being fed organic, non-GMO feed and having outdoor access. Importantly, it also means no antibiotics were used during the bird's life. One exception is that some organic standards may still permit antibiotic use in hatcheries. If you want to be completely certain, look for an additional 'Raised Without Antibiotics' claim alongside the organic seal.
- No Medically Important Antibiotics: This label means the chicken was not given antibiotics considered important for human medicine, but it may have been given other antibiotics. This is a step up from conventional but less strict than 'Raised Without Antibiotics'.
- Vegetable-Fed: This label only refers to the chicken's diet and has no bearing on antibiotic use. It means the feed did not contain animal by-products.
- Free-Range: This term simply means the chickens had some form of outdoor access, but it doesn’t say anything about whether they received antibiotics or not.
The Health Implications of Antibiotic Residues
The primary concern with antibiotic residues is their potential contribution to antibiotic resistance, a global public health crisis. Continuous exposure of bacteria to low-level antibiotics can lead to the development of resistant strains. These 'superbugs' can then be transferred to humans through the food chain, making human infections more difficult and costly to treat. Other potential health risks include allergic reactions in sensitive individuals and disruption of the natural balance of beneficial gut bacteria.
A Comparison: Conventional vs. Antibiotic-Free Chicken
To help you decide what's right for your nutrition plan, here is a comparison of conventional chicken and antibiotic-free options based on typical industry practices.
| Feature | Conventional Chicken | Antibiotic-Free Chicken | 
|---|---|---|
| Use of Antibiotics | Permitted for disease treatment, prevention, and historically for growth promotion. Must follow withdrawal periods. | Never administered antibiotics during the bird's lifetime. | 
| Labeling | Often includes 'enhanced' (injected with solution) and may not specify antibiotic use. | Clearly labeled 'Raised Without Antibiotics' or 'Certified Organic' (which bans antibiotics). | 
| Animal Conditions | Varies widely, often involves intensive indoor confinement with higher risk of disease. | Generally includes higher welfare standards and outdoor access, especially for organic. | 
| Price Point | Typically less expensive due to efficiency of large-scale production. | Higher price point reflects stricter farming methods and third-party verification. | 
| Potential Risks | Possible exposure to trace residues contributing to antibiotic resistance. | Reduced risk of contributing to antibiotic resistance through poultry consumption. | 
Strategies for Safer Poultry Choices
Making conscious decisions when buying poultry can significantly reduce your exposure to antibiotics. Here are some actionable steps for your next trip to the grocery store.
5 Steps to Ensure Your Chicken Is Antibiotic-Free
- Look for Explicit Labels: Always seek out labels like “Raised Without Antibiotics,” “No Antibiotics Ever,” or the “Certified Organic” seal. These are the most reliable indicators.
- Choose Trusted Brands: Research brands known for their commitment to high-welfare, antibiotic-free farming. This helps build trust beyond just the label.
- Read the Fine Print: Don't be fooled by vague claims like “naturally raised” or “farm-fresh.” These phrases are unregulated and do not guarantee antibiotic-free production.
- Consider Local Farms: Buying directly from a local farm or butcher can give you more transparency. You can often ask direct questions about their practices and be more confident in your purchase.
- Prioritize Third-Party Certification: Look for third-party certifications, such as those from the USDA or animal welfare organizations, which add an extra layer of verification.
